#cfe888 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cfe888 is composed of 81.2% red, 91%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.4%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 75.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 72.2%. #cfe888 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9fd111.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#cfe888 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cfe888 has RGB values of R:207, G:232,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 13625480.

Hex triplet cfe888 #cfe888
RGB Decimal 207, 232, 136 rgb(207,232,136)
RGB Percent 81.2, 91, 53.3 rgb(81.2%,91%,53.3%)
CMYK 11, 0, 41, 9
HSL 75.6°, 67.6, 72.2 hsl(75.6,67.6%,72.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 75.6°, 41.4, 91
Web Safe ccff99 #ccff99
CIE-LAB 88.331, -23.106, 43.897
XYZ 59.032, 72.756, 34.225
xyY 0.356, 0.438, 72.756
CIE-LCH 88.331, 49.606, 117.761
CIE-LUV 88.331, -10.791, 62.277
Hunter-Lab 85.297, -25.735, 35.918
Binary 11001111, 11101000, 10001000

Shades and Tints of #cfe888

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0d02 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.
